Authors Comments:
I've used this knife for over a decade to field dress hundreds of elk and have tinkered with a myriad of angles and finish levels. I finally settled on 20 degrees for the skinner with a moderately toothy finish of 3.5um and for a final bevel of 17 degrees for the hide blade with a polished finish of .25um. I relieved the shoulders on the hide blade down to 13 degrees and the added the micro-bevel. With continued stropping at 15 degrees, the edge is now nicely convex.

Authors Comments:
After several months of experimenting, I've settled on 17 degrees for this knife. It gives great performance and holds its edge well. I keep it pretty polished for show and sometimes it's a little too smooth for the work it does so I might put a slightly toothy, almost invisible micro-bevel on it.
